WebMay 7, 2024 · Hepatorenal syndrome is a severe complication of end-stage cirrhosis characterized by increased splanchnic blood flow, hyperdynamic state, a state of decreased central volume, activation of vasoconstrictor systems, and extreme kidney vasoconstriction leading to decreased GFR. WebGlomerular filtration rate (GFR) is the volume of fluid filtered from the kidney's glomerular capillaries into Bowman's capsule per unit time.8 It is determined by the balance of hydrostatic and colloid osmotic forces across the glomerular membrane in addition to the permeability and surface area of this membrane.
